There is a bug in some earlier versions of Netscape for Windows
(particularly 1.1N) that causes Netscape to send rubbish to the
DNS server to resolve when it loads the home page (or perhaps even
any initial page, if a home page is not set). I've traced this and
seen netscape send this rubbish myself. If you hit the `home' button
after this it sends out the proper request the second time.
